The East Asia Center was founded in 1975 to provide a forum for faculty and student interest in East and Southeast Asia and to encourage extra-curricular lectures and activities. It is essentially an interdisciplinary organization of faculty associates, each of whom is a full member of a department. Likewise, Asia-related courses are taught as part of the various departmental curricula. Therefore, the Center does not have its own faculty or course offerings. However, it does have the tasks of administering the interdisciplinary MA and MBA/MA degree programs in Asian Studies, encouraging and coordinating Asia-related activities, especially the lecture series, and administering a travel grant program for student and faculty travel to Asia.
